cover image Accidentally Yours

Accidentally Yours

Susan Mallery, read by Therese Plummer. Brilliance Audio, , unabridged, eight CDs, 9 hrs., $19.99 ISBN 978-1-4418-7631-7

Spunky, determined single mom Carrie tricks billionaire Nathan into donating $15 million to scientific research to find a cure for her son’s fatal disease. Infuriated at being manipulated, Nathan insists Carrie accompany him to social events for publicity purposes. Predictably, they start out disliking each other but end up falling in love. Despite this by-the-numbers plot, Theresa Plummer’s lively, effervescent narration elevates the story and creates a truly entertaining audiobook. With every line, Plummer sounds like a close friend, eager to confide a personal story and reveal fascinating tidbits of information. Her bubbly, you-won’t-believe-what-happened-next enthusiasm is contagious and draws the listener into this breezy romance. And while some of the voices Plummer creates for the book’s characters miss the mark—her male voices often sounds similar and her German accent is not convincing—her emotional expressiveness, enthusiasm, and great comedic timing make this a delightful listen. An HQN Books paperback. (July)
